Give AI agents an evidence-first UDT audit workflow.
This skill reviews UDT definitions, instances, exports, and reachable Gateway evidence without mixing configured state with runtime proof. It identifies inherited drift, broken dependencies, risky scripts, alarms, history settings, writable surfaces, and missing validation evidence.

Why it was made
- Compares definitions and instances instead of reviewing each tag in isolation.
- Surfaces parameter, override, dependency, event-script, alarm, historian, and writable-tag risk.
- Labels unavailable live checks as evidence gaps instead of guessing.
- Keeps remediation separate from the initial audit until the user explicitly asks for changes.

Expected output
- Inventories definitions, instances, parameters, members, overrides, and external dependencies.
- Ranks concrete configuration risks with the evidence that supports each finding.
- Separates exported configuration observations from live runtime behavior.
- Provides a prioritized verification and remediation plan without silently mutating resources.
